Karin Lim has been a partner at Presgrave & Matthews since September 1, 1991. She was admitted as an Advocate and Solicitor of the High Court of Malaya on January 2, 1987, and has been practicing with the firm ever since. Additionally, she is admitted as a Barrister and Solicitor in the State of Victoria, Australia. Karin holds a Bachelor of Laws degree from the Australian National University in Canberra and a double degree in Economics and Law, with a major in Accounting.
With over 38 years of experience as a litigator, Karin leads the litigation practice at Presgrave & Matthews as the managing partner. She has a dynamic and extensive practice, regularly appearing in hearings, trials, and appeals. She is frequently called upon to act as senior counsel in a wide range of litigation matters, including administrative law, commercial and contract disputes, civil litigation, probate and wills, land disputes, and employment law.
Karin specializes in High Court and appellate litigation before the Court of Appeal and the Federal Court of Malaysia. Many of her cases have resulted in reported judgments in the renowned Law Journals.
Her clientele includes private individuals, financial institutions, multinational corporations, publicly listed companies, local authorities, professional associations, joint management bodies, management committees, and state authorities.
Karin has handled complex and high-profile probate and wills litigation, including disputes over contested wills, corporate conflicts, commercial contracts, employment matters, intellectual property, and trust cases.
She is also highly experienced in compulsory land acquisition matters and regularly represents clients in Land Reference hearings, judicial reviews, and appeals at all levels of the Malaysian courts under the Land Acquisition Act 1960 and the National Land Code 1965. Additionally, she appears before State Appeal Boards in planning permission hearings and judicial reviews under town and country planning legislation.
Karin has served as lead counsel for various local authorities, including Majlis Perbandaran Pulau Pinang (MPPP), Majlis Bandaraya Subang Jaya (MBSJ), and Majlis Bandaraya Seberang Perai (MBSP), in significant legal proceedings.
She has also represented the Chief Minister Incorporated (CMI) in landmark cases involving land acquisition for educational purposes and constitutional matters. Furthermore, she and the firm have acted on behalf of the State Authority by way of Fiat in the Ann Joo Steel case and has represented notable entities such as the Penang Development Corporation (PDC), Perbadanan Bekalan Air Pulau Pinang (PBA), Universiti Sains Malaysia (USM), and Koperasi Tunas Muda (KTM).
